数据库服务器性能要求高吗,深入解析数据库服务器性能要求,高吗?如何优化?
- 综合资讯
- 2024-12-22 03:46:05
- 2

数据库服务器性能要求较高,需关注CPU、内存、磁盘I/O等关键指标。优化方法包括合理配置硬件资源、选择合适的存储引擎、优化查询语句、定期维护等。...
数据库服务器性能要求较高,需关注CPU、内存、磁盘I/O等关键指标。优化方法包括合理配置硬件资源、选择合适的存储引擎、优化查询语句、定期维护等。
随着信息技术的飞速发展,数据库已经成为企业、政府、科研等各个领域不可或缺的核心组成部分,数据库服务器作为存储、管理和处理数据的平台,其性能直接影响到整个系统的稳定性和效率,数据库服务器性能要求高吗?如何优化数据库服务器性能?本文将深入探讨这些问题。
数据库服务器性能要求
1、高并发处理能力
在当今互联网时代,数据库服务器需要处理海量的并发请求,高并发处理能力是数据库服务器性能的重要指标,以下几种方式可以提高数据库服务器的并发处理能力:
(1)优化硬件配置:提高CPU、内存、硬盘等硬件性能,为数据库服务器提供更强大的计算和存储能力。
(2)合理配置数据库参数:调整数据库参数,如连接数、会话数、缓存大小等,以满足高并发需求。
(3)采用分布式数据库技术:将数据分散存储在多个节点上,通过负载均衡和分布式处理,提高并发处理能力。
2、快速查询响应速度
数据库服务器需要具备快速查询响应速度,以满足用户对数据的高效访问需求,以下几种方式可以提高查询响应速度:
(1)优化索引:合理设计索引,提高查询效率。
(2)优化查询语句:简化查询语句,避免复杂的嵌套查询和子查询。
(3)使用缓存技术:将常用数据缓存到内存中,减少磁盘I/O操作,提高查询速度。
3、数据安全性
数据库服务器需要具备较高的数据安全性,防止数据泄露、篡改和丢失,以下几种方式可以提高数据安全性:
(1)采用加密技术:对敏感数据进行加密存储和传输,确保数据安全。
(2)设置访问权限:合理设置用户权限,限制对数据的访问和操作。
(3)定期备份:定期备份数据库,防止数据丢失。
4、可扩展性
数据库服务器需要具备良好的可扩展性,以满足业务发展需求,以下几种方式可以提高数据库服务器的可扩展性:
(1)采用模块化设计:将数据库服务器分为多个模块,便于扩展和维护。
(2)支持集群部署:通过集群部署,提高数据库服务器的可用性和性能。
(3)采用云数据库技术:将数据库部署在云端,实现弹性扩展。
数据库服务器性能优化策略
1、硬件优化
(1)提高CPU性能:选择高性能的CPU,提高数据库服务器的计算能力。
(2)增加内存容量:提高内存容量,减少磁盘I/O操作,提高数据库性能。
(3)选择高速硬盘:采用SSD等高速硬盘,提高数据读写速度。
2、软件优化
(1)优化数据库配置:调整数据库参数,如连接数、会话数、缓存大小等,以提高性能。
(2)优化索引:合理设计索引,提高查询效率。
(3)优化查询语句:简化查询语句,避免复杂的嵌套查询和子查询。
3、数据库设计优化
(1)合理设计表结构:避免冗余字段,提高数据存储效率。
(2)优化数据类型:选择合适的数据类型,减少存储空间占用。
(3)合理分区:将数据分区存储,提高查询效率。
4、网络优化
(1)优化网络配置:调整网络参数,提高数据传输速度。
(2)使用负载均衡技术:通过负载均衡,提高数据库服务器的并发处理能力。
数据库服务器性能要求较高,需要从硬件、软件、数据库设计、网络等多个方面进行优化,通过合理配置硬件、优化软件、优化数据库设计、优化网络配置等手段,可以提高数据库服务器的性能,满足业务发展需求,在实际应用中,需要根据具体情况进行综合分析和调整,以达到最佳性能。
本文链接:https://www.zhitaoyun.cn/1714143.html
发表评论